Avianca announces measures for frequent travelers

Avianca announced that it has taken measures for its users who belong to Avianca’s LifeMiles Frequent Flyer Program due to the travel restrictions that governments have implemented due to the covid-19 pandemic “as a gesture of support and tranquility.”

“We are grateful to our clients for their continued support and loyalty during these complex weeks for the aviation and tourism sector. Most of the 9.5 million LifeMiles members are currently unable to travel due to border closures in various countries. The priority now is to take care of your health and stay home. That is why we want them to be calm about their miles and their status and maintain their current benefits so that they can enjoy them when they are ready to travel again, ”said Zwannee Linares, director of loyalty of Avianca, in a press release.

The measures taken are as follows: all members who gained Elite status on March 1, 2020 will have their status extended until January 31, 2022. The term will automatically extend on March 1, 2021, without need for customers to contact the airline.

LifeMiles’ rating system (miles, segments and dollars) will be reduced soon. The enabler of miles flown with Avianca remains at 60%. Additionally, all changes to tickets purchased with miles are exempt from penalty. Customers will be able to request the changes, through the call center or LiveChat, until December 31, 2020 with a maximum flight date until June 30, 2021.

Likewise, the expiration of those miles that expired between April 1 and December 31, 2020 will be paused. This will be done automatically, without the need for customers to contact the airline.
